In the midst of uncertain times its normal for staff, parents and students to feel a heightened level of anxiety.
I’ve attached the Australian Psychological Society’s tips for coping with anxiety around COVID-19.
It includes suggestions for managing discussions with curious students and can also be a useful resource for parents.
A special message from me is to take care of yourself – not just physically, but mentally. Engage in some self-care – whether that be mindfulness, exercise, sleep or reading.
Check-in with yourself about how you’re managing your own wellbeing.
